Founder of 'Mothers at the Front' calls on IDF Chief: 'Soldiers are exhausted - mentally too'

|
Attorney Ayelet Hashahar Saydoff, founder and head of the 'Mothers at the Front' movement, addressed IDF Chief of Staff Lt. Gen. Eyal Zamir's decision to examine the possibility of changing the recognition law for fallen IDF soldiers, stating: "Chief of Staff - the obvious question is what are you doing to prevent the next suicide? Have you directed the IDF to maintain contact with combat shock victims? It's time you say things courageously and publicly - the IDF is exhausted, the soldiers are exhausted - and their souls are exhausted. End this cursed war, bring back the hostages and our children home and begin the rehabilitation operation for the army and the soldiers."
